Web14 nov. 2024 · Eco-packaging is physically designed to optimise materials and energy. It optimises the use of recycled or renewable source materials. Eco-packaging items are manufactured using clean production technologies and ethical practices. It’s recovered and utilised in biological and/or industrial closed-loop cycles. Adjust the range and settings of … Web29 apr. 2024 · The most commonly used gases for the packaging of meat is CO2, N2 and O2 although other gases including CO, N2O, Argon, SO2 and Ozone have been tried to a limited extent (Church, 1994). The most commonly used gas mixture for fresh red meat is high O2, which has a minimum 60-70% O2 and 30-40% CO2 (Walsh and Kerry, 2002).
